I have a question. I recently submitted an article for publication as first author, and I listed it as "under review" on my CV at the time of my application submission. It just got accepted for publication. Is it worth it to email POIs indicating that it has been accepted, or does it not make much of a difference?

Link to comment
Share on other sites

14 minutes ago, clinicalnerd said:

I have a question. I recently submitted an article for publication as first author, and I listed it as "under review" on my CV at the time of my application submission. It just got accepted for publication. Is it worth it to email POIs indicating that it has been accepted, or does it not make much of a difference?

Congrats on your publication! I would bring it along to the interviews or offer to share it during interviews. But I wouldn’t email POIs just to tell them that it got accepted. I personally think that it would sound pushy. Not sure how others feel about this.
